This is a system called the Manor System. The lord of the manor would hire knights. To attracted workers the lord would say that his soldiers would protect the serfs who lived on the farm. In return the serfs would have to farm on the land. So the knights made the manor militarily self sufficient and the serfs' farming made them economically selfsufficient

Subsistence farming can be found on all continents, but it is most prevalent in Africa, Asia, and parts of South America. These regions often have rural communities with limited access to modern agricultural resources, leading them to rely on small-scale, traditional farming methods to meet their basic food needs.
